Japan exports rise 3.1% year/year in Oct

2024.11.19 19:26

TOKYO (Reuters) – Japanese exports rose 3.1% year-on-year in October, rebounding from a 1.7% drop in September, data from the Ministry of Finance showed on Wednesday.

The result compared with a 2.2% increase expected by economists in a Reuters poll.

Imports increased 0.4% in October from a year earlier, versus a 0.3% decrease expected by economists.

As a result, the trade balance stood at a deficit of 461.2 billion yen ($2.98 billion), compared with the forecast of a deficit of 360.4 billion yen.

($1 = 154.7000 yen)
